Automatic forming and bending device for stainless steel coil

By combining hydraulically driven pressing and cutting blades with an automated motor roller device, the problem of low efficiency in traditional stainless steel coil bending equipment due to manual operation has been solved. This enables rapid and precise forming and cutting of stainless steel coils, improving production efficiency and finished product quality.

Description

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of stainless steel coil processing technology, and in particular to an automated forming and bending device for stainless steel coils. Background Technology

[0002] Stainless steel coil bending is a metal processing technology that aims to plastically deform stainless steel coils by applying external force to achieve a predetermined bending shape and size. This technology plays an important role in the manufacture of various metal products, especially when components with complex shapes and structures are required. Stainless steel is widely used in various industrial fields due to its excellent corrosion resistance and mechanical properties, and the bending process further expands its application scope. In order to meet the modern industrial demand for high quality and high precision of stainless steel products, stainless steel coil bending equipment has emerged.

[0003] Traditional stainless steel coil bending equipment requires manual placement of the steel coil under the pressure knife, followed by manual bending upwards or downwards. After bending, the coil is manually cut to complete the material cutting. Traditional stainless steel coil bending equipment is manually operated and has a low degree of automation, resulting in limited production efficiency and difficulty in meeting the needs of large-scale production. Manual placement of the steel coil is prone to deviation, which may affect the quality of the finished product. Utility Model Content

[0004] To overcome the above shortcomings, this utility model provides an automated forming and bending device for stainless steel coils, aiming to improve the problem that traditional devices rely on manual operation and the steel coils are prone to deviation, affecting the quality of the finished product.

[0005] To achieve the above objectives, the present invention provides the following technical solution: an automated forming and bending device for stainless steel coils, comprising a worktable, wherein a bending component is provided on the upper surface of the worktable;

[0006] The bending assembly includes a pressure knife, a fixing plate is fixedly connected to the upper surface of the pressure knife, a base plate is provided below the pressure knife, a hydraulic actuator is fixedly connected to the upper surface of the base plate, the output end of the hydraulic actuator is fixedly connected to the fixing plate, the lower surface of the base plate is fixedly connected to the upper surface of the worktable, a cutting knife is provided on one side of the pressure knife, a pressure groove is opened inside the base plate, a through groove is opened inside the base plate, a support plate is fixedly connected to the upper surface of the worktable, a rotating shaft is rotatably connected inside the support plate, a roller is fixedly connected to the outer wall of the rotating shaft, a motor is fixedly connected to one side of the outer wall of the support plate, the output end of the motor is fixedly connected to the rotating shaft, and a correction assembly is provided on one side of the roller.

[0007] Furthermore, the correction assembly includes a slider, a fixing block fixedly connected to the outer wall of the slider, a sliding rod slidably connected inside the slider, a fixing plate two fixedly connected to the lower surface of the sliding rod, a support block fixedly connected to the lower surface of the fixing plate two, a rack fixedly connected to the outer wall of the slider, a rotating shaft one rotatably connected inside the worktable, a gear fixedly connected to one end of the rotating shaft one, the outer wall of the gear meshing with the rack, a hydraulic rod fixedly connected to the inner wall of the fixing plate two, and the output end of the hydraulic rod fixedly connected to the fixing block.

[0008] Furthermore, the lower surface of the support block is fixedly connected to the upper surface of the workbench.

[0009] Furthermore, both ends of the slide bar are fixedly connected to limit blocks, and the lower surface of the limit blocks is fixedly connected to the upper surface of the second fixing plate.

[0010] Furthermore, a support is fixedly connected to the lower surface of the workbench.

[0011] Furthermore, the lower surface of the motor is fixed to the upper surface of the workbench.

[0012] Furthermore, four rollers are provided, and the four rollers are arranged symmetrically in an up-down manner.

[0013] Furthermore, four hydraulic actuators are provided, and the hydraulic actuators are located at the four corners of the base plate.

[0014] This utility model has the following beneficial effects:

[0015] 1. In this utility model, the hydraulic device drives the pressure knife to cooperate with the pressure groove on the base plate to perform bending operation. Combined with the cutting function of the cutter, the forming, bending and cutting of stainless steel coils can be completed quickly and accurately. The motor drives the roller to rotate, realizing automatic feeding and unloading of stainless steel coils, which improves production efficiency, ensures the consistency of product size and shape, and meets the needs of large-scale production.

[0016] 2. In this utility model, a hydraulic rod is used to push the fixed block to move. Through the sliding of the slider on the slide rod and the meshing transmission of the rack and gear, the moving distance and direction of the fixed block can be precisely controlled, thereby accurately correcting the stainless steel coil and ensuring that the stainless steel coil always maintains the correct position during the transmission process, avoiding processing errors and scrap caused by position deviation. [0027] Working principle: The stainless steel coil is placed in the gap between the rollers 20. The motor 10 drives the rotating shaft 22 to rotate, which in turn drives the rollers 20 to rotate. The rotation of the rollers 20 provides forward power for the stainless steel coil, realizing its transmission. The hydraulic device 2 is connected to the pressure knife 6 through the fixed plate 1. When the hydraulic device 2 is working, its output end drives the pressure knife 6 to move up and down. When the pressure knife 6 presses down, it cooperates with the pressure groove 8 on the base plate 3 to perform a bending operation on the stainless steel coil. At the same time, the cutting knife 7 can cooperate with the through groove 9 to complete the cutting action. The output end of the hydraulic rod 19 pushes the fixed block 14 to move. The fixed block 14 drives the slider 13 to slide on the slide rod 12. When the slider 13 moves, the rack 15 drives the gear 16 to rotate. The gear 16 is connected to the rotating shaft 17, which rotates inside the worktable 4. Through this transmission method, the moving distance and direction of the slider 13 can be controlled, thereby adjusting the position of the fixed block 14 and correcting the stainless steel coil to ensure accurate positioning of the stainless steel coil during transmission.
